loadFrontAgenda = function (e) {
	hrefs = $('front-kalender').getElementsByTagName('a');
	for (i=0,j=hrefs.length;i<j;i++) {
		Event.observe(hrefs[i],'click',clickAgendaItem,true);
	}
}

clickAgendaItem = function (e) {
	Event.stop(e);
	Element.getElementsByClassName('details');
	ps = document.getElementsByClassName('details',Event.element(e).parentNode);
	if (ps[0].style.display=='none' || ps[0].style.display=='') {
		ps[0].style.display='block';
	} else {
		ps[0].style.display='none';
	}
};

Event.observe(window,'load',loadFrontAgenda);
